на некоторых видеоплеерах например vimu player при включении звука E-AC3 начинает тормозить изображение а звук идет нормально
притормаживает изображение
проблема с медиаплеером Ugoos тв приставка Ugos ut 8 pro / Москва
Комментарии (1):
Ремонт ТВ-приставок и медиаплееров в Москве service.fixim.ru
78 просмотров
добавить комментарий...
лагает постоянно при коротких буферизациях но они я так понимаю что то с кодеком, остальные плееры с этой проблемой либо выдают видео нормально а звук дольби джитал либо либо звук E-AC3 лагает(
Vimu player выдает оба формата с E-AC3 и джитал
также с другими кодеками порой проблема
то есть когда я в настройках ставил только аппаратные декодеры то плеер отказывался играть видео, когда поставил программные+аппаратные проверял Vimu player и Kodi у коди тоже самое, то видео начало играть с выше представленной проблемой на vimu, на kodi нет проблем с vimu такие тормоза как будто процессор перегружен
тв приставка Ugoos Ut8 pro с процем Amlogic S912, рaм 2гб, есть root права
драйвер либо прошивка ставится только производителем
ugoos.net/ugoos-ut8-pro-firmware(ссылка на прошивку)
тв приставка 8.0.0 oreo
драйвер на звук ставил universal codec by mixer тоже самое
был старый Ugoos AM6 S905x3 с ним все нормально работало
но vimu player не ставился при включении выдавал что нет поддержки neon и не ставился
kodi играл нормально)
хотя процессор как бы вообще должен быть мощнее S912
S912 Cortex-A53 и
S905X3 Cortex-A55
энергоэффективность лучше у A55
какие могут быть причины?
в vimu player есть возможность сменить драйвер аудио там есть OpenSL ES и аудиотрек есть еще один называется AAudio что это может помочь?
По предоставленной информации, проблема сводится к тому, что на приставке Ugoos UT8 Pro (Amlogic S912, Android 8.0) в некоторых видеоплеерах (Vimu, Kodi) при воспроизведении видео со звуком в формате E-AC3 (Dolby Digital Plus) возникает подтормаживание изображения, при этом звук воспроизводится нормально. На другой приставке (Ugoos AM6 S905X3) такая проблема отсутствовала.
Рассмотрим возможные причины и решения.
1. Аппаратное ускорение и декодирование
Проблема может быть связана с неправильной работой аппаратных декодеров для определенных кодеков на чипе S912.
* Что проверить в Vimu Player:
* Откройте Настройки -> Декодирование.
* Поэкспериментируйте с настройками Аппаратный декодер. Попробуйте разные варианты:
* `Amlogic HW+` (нативный декодер для вашего чипа)
* `MediaCodec` (стандартный Android API)
* *Из вашего описания:* Если при выборе только аппаратных декодеров видео не воспроизводится, это плохой знак. Это указывает на проблему с драйверами или прошивкой. Возможно, для конкретно этого контейнера или комбинации видео/аудио кодеков аппаратный декодер не справляется.
* Попробуйте также настройку "Аппаратный декодер для всего" (если есть) — выключите ее.
* Включите опцию "Использовать MediaCodec для аудио". Это может перенаправить декодирование аудио на другой, более стабильный механизм.
* Что проверить в Kodi:
* Перейдите в Настройки -> Система -> Видео -> Ускорение (нужно включить режим "Эксперт" в левом нижнем углу настроек).
* Поэкспериментируйте с настройками:
* "Разрешить аппаратное ускорение - MediaCodec" (включите/выключите).
* "Использовать ускоренную буферизацию MediaCodec (поверхностная)" (включите/выключите). Иногда проблема именно в этом.
* Также есть настройки, специфичные для производителя SoC. Ищите пункты вроде "Аппаратное ускорение Amlogic" и пробуйте менять его состояние.
2. Аудиодрайверы и вывод звука
Проблема может быть не в декодировании видео, а в том, как обрабатывается аудиопоток. Если аудиодрайвер работает с задержками или вызывает блокировки, это может влиять на весь процесс рендеринга.
* OpenSL ES vs AAudio в Vimu:
* OpenSL ES — старый, но универсальный API для аудио.
* AAudio — новый низкоуровневый API, представленный в Android 8.0 (Oreo), который предназначен для высокопроизводительных аудиоприложений с минимальной задержкой.
* Обязательно попробуйте переключиться на AAudio. Это может кардинально решить проблему, так как этот драйвер эффективнее управляет аудиобуферами и меньше нагружает систему. Если этот пункт активен, выберите его.
* Настройки аудио в системе Android:
* Убедитесь, что в настройках самой приставки (Настройки Android -> Звук) не включены какие-либо обработки звука (эквилайзеры, виртуальные объемные звучания и т.д.), которые могут конфликтовать. Попробуйте их отключить.
* Проверьте режим вывода звука. Если есть возможность, попробуйте переключиться с "Авто" на конкретный формат, например, "PCM". Это заставит приставку декодировать E-AC3 внутренее, а на ресивер/ТВ передавать уже несжатый звук. Это может снять нагрузку с аудиопотока.
3. Проблема прошивки/драйверов
Ваше наблюдение — ключевое. На приставке с S905X3 такой проблемы нет, а на более старой S912 — есть. Это почти на 100% указывает на недоработанную прошивку или драйверы от производителя (Ugoos) для данной конкретной модели (UT8 Pro) и Android 8.
* Обновление прошивки: Убедитесь, что у вас установлена самая последняя версия прошивки с официального сайта. Производитель мог исправить проблемы с кодеками в новых версиях.
* Смена прошивки (крайняя мера): Для чипов Amlogic существует сообщество энтузиастов, которые создают кастомные прошивки (например, на базе CoreELEC или других проектов). Однако для TV-приставок на Android это рискованно и может привести к "кирпичу". Этот вариант стоит рассматривать только если вы уверены в своих силах и нашли проверенную прошивку именно для вашей модели.
4. Анализ производительности
Чтобы убедиться, что проблема в загрузке процессора, установите приложение вроде CPU Monitor или CPU-Z. Запустите видео с E-AC3 в Vimu и посмотрите на график загрузки CPU. Если одно из ядер (или все) уходит в 100%, а видео лагает — проблема точно в недостаточной производительности программного декодирования или в кривом драйвере, который неэффективно использует аппаратный декодер.
План действий по пунктам:
1. В Vimu Player:
* Переключите аудиодрайвер на AAudio.
* Попробуйте разные комбинации аппаратных декодеров (`Amlogic HW+`, `MediaCodec`).
* Включите опцию "Использовать MediaCodec для аудио".
2. В Kodi:
* Поиграйте с настройками ускорения в экспертном режиме, особенно с поверхностной буферизацией и аппаратным ускорением Amlogic.
3. В системных настройках Android:
* Отключите все звуковые эффекты.
* Попробуйте сменить формат вывода звука на PCM.
4. Проверьте обновления прошивки на официальном сайте Ugoos.
5. Если ничего не помогает, considere использование альтернативного плеера, который заведомо хорошо работает с вашим железом. Например, Just (Video) Player с его собственными экспериментальными кодеками иногда творит чудеса на проблемном железе.
К сожалению, если проблема на уровне драйверов прошивки, решить её программными средствами внутри плеера может быть невозможно. В таком случае либо ждать обновления от Ugoos, либо смириться с необходимостью перекодирования аудиодорожки в AC3 или PCM в проблемных видеофайлах.
Vimu player выдает оба формата с E-AC3 и джитал
также с другими кодеками порой проблема
то есть когда я в настройках ставил только аппаратные декодеры то плеер отказывался играть видео, когда поставил программные+аппаратные проверял Vimu player и Kodi у коди тоже самое, то видео начало играть с выше представленной проблемой на vimu, на kodi нет проблем с vimu такие тормоза как будто процессор перегружен
тв приставка Ugoos Ut8 pro с процем Amlogic S912, рaм 2гб, есть root права
драйвер либо прошивка ставится только производителем
ugoos.net/ugoos-ut8-pro-firmware(ссылка на прошивку)
тв приставка 8.0.0 oreo
драйвер на звук ставил universal codec by mixer тоже самое
был старый Ugoos AM6 S905x3 с ним все нормально работало
но vimu player не ставился при включении выдавал что нет поддержки neon и не ставился
kodi играл нормально)
хотя процессор как бы вообще должен быть мощнее S912
S912 Cortex-A53 и
S905X3 Cortex-A55
энергоэффективность лучше у A55
какие могут быть причины?
в vimu player есть возможность сменить драйвер аудио там есть OpenSL ES и аудиотрек есть еще один называется AAudio что это может помочь?
По предоставленной информации, проблема сводится к тому, что на приставке Ugoos UT8 Pro (Amlogic S912, Android 8.0) в некоторых видеоплеерах (Vimu, Kodi) при воспроизведении видео со звуком в формате E-AC3 (Dolby Digital Plus) возникает подтормаживание изображения, при этом звук воспроизводится нормально. На другой приставке (Ugoos AM6 S905X3) такая проблема отсутствовала.
Рассмотрим возможные причины и решения.
1. Аппаратное ускорение и декодирование
Проблема может быть связана с неправильной работой аппаратных декодеров для определенных кодеков на чипе S912.
* Что проверить в Vimu Player:
* Откройте Настройки -> Декодирование.
* Поэкспериментируйте с настройками Аппаратный декодер. Попробуйте разные варианты:
* `Amlogic HW+` (нативный декодер для вашего чипа)
* `MediaCodec` (стандартный Android API)
* *Из вашего описания:* Если при выборе только аппаратных декодеров видео не воспроизводится, это плохой знак. Это указывает на проблему с драйверами или прошивкой. Возможно, для конкретно этого контейнера или комбинации видео/аудио кодеков аппаратный декодер не справляется.
* Попробуйте также настройку "Аппаратный декодер для всего" (если есть) — выключите ее.
* Включите опцию "Использовать MediaCodec для аудио". Это может перенаправить декодирование аудио на другой, более стабильный механизм.
* Что проверить в Kodi:
* Перейдите в Настройки -> Система -> Видео -> Ускорение (нужно включить режим "Эксперт" в левом нижнем углу настроек).
* Поэкспериментируйте с настройками:
* "Разрешить аппаратное ускорение - MediaCodec" (включите/выключите).
* "Использовать ускоренную буферизацию MediaCodec (поверхностная)" (включите/выключите). Иногда проблема именно в этом.
* Также есть настройки, специфичные для производителя SoC. Ищите пункты вроде "Аппаратное ускорение Amlogic" и пробуйте менять его состояние.
2. Аудиодрайверы и вывод звука
Проблема может быть не в декодировании видео, а в том, как обрабатывается аудиопоток. Если аудиодрайвер работает с задержками или вызывает блокировки, это может влиять на весь процесс рендеринга.
* OpenSL ES vs AAudio в Vimu:
* OpenSL ES — старый, но универсальный API для аудио.
* AAudio — новый низкоуровневый API, представленный в Android 8.0 (Oreo), который предназначен для высокопроизводительных аудиоприложений с минимальной задержкой.
* Обязательно попробуйте переключиться на AAudio. Это может кардинально решить проблему, так как этот драйвер эффективнее управляет аудиобуферами и меньше нагружает систему. Если этот пункт активен, выберите его.
* Настройки аудио в системе Android:
* Убедитесь, что в настройках самой приставки (Настройки Android -> Звук) не включены какие-либо обработки звука (эквилайзеры, виртуальные объемные звучания и т.д.), которые могут конфликтовать. Попробуйте их отключить.
* Проверьте режим вывода звука. Если есть возможность, попробуйте переключиться с "Авто" на конкретный формат, например, "PCM". Это заставит приставку декодировать E-AC3 внутренее, а на ресивер/ТВ передавать уже несжатый звук. Это может снять нагрузку с аудиопотока.
3. Проблема прошивки/драйверов
Ваше наблюдение — ключевое. На приставке с S905X3 такой проблемы нет, а на более старой S912 — есть. Это почти на 100% указывает на недоработанную прошивку или драйверы от производителя (Ugoos) для данной конкретной модели (UT8 Pro) и Android 8.
* Обновление прошивки: Убедитесь, что у вас установлена самая последняя версия прошивки с официального сайта. Производитель мог исправить проблемы с кодеками в новых версиях.
* Смена прошивки (крайняя мера): Для чипов Amlogic существует сообщество энтузиастов, которые создают кастомные прошивки (например, на базе CoreELEC или других проектов). Однако для TV-приставок на Android это рискованно и может привести к "кирпичу". Этот вариант стоит рассматривать только если вы уверены в своих силах и нашли проверенную прошивку именно для вашей модели.
4. Анализ производительности
Чтобы убедиться, что проблема в загрузке процессора, установите приложение вроде CPU Monitor или CPU-Z. Запустите видео с E-AC3 в Vimu и посмотрите на график загрузки CPU. Если одно из ядер (или все) уходит в 100%, а видео лагает — проблема точно в недостаточной производительности программного декодирования или в кривом драйвере, который неэффективно использует аппаратный декодер.
План действий по пунктам:
1. В Vimu Player:
* Переключите аудиодрайвер на AAudio.
* Попробуйте разные комбинации аппаратных декодеров (`Amlogic HW+`, `MediaCodec`).
* Включите опцию "Использовать MediaCodec для аудио".
2. В Kodi:
* Поиграйте с настройками ускорения в экспертном режиме, особенно с поверхностной буферизацией и аппаратным ускорением Amlogic.
3. В системных настройках Android:
* Отключите все звуковые эффекты.
* Попробуйте сменить формат вывода звука на PCM.
4. Проверьте обновления прошивки на официальном сайте Ugoos.
5. Если ничего не помогает, considere использование альтернативного плеера, который заведомо хорошо работает с вашим железом. Например, Just (Video) Player с его собственными экспериментальными кодеками иногда творит чудеса на проблемном железе.
К сожалению, если проблема на уровне драйверов прошивки, решить её программными средствами внутри плеера может быть невозможно. В таком случае либо ждать обновления от Ugoos, либо смириться с необходимостью перекодирования аудиодорожки в AC3 или PCM в проблемных видеофайлах.
26 сентября
добавить комментарий
другие решения ожидаются…
Видео с YouTube на эту тему
Знаете, как решить эту проблему?
Поделитесь своим знанием!
Ваш способ решения:
Наиболее похожие проблемы из этого раздела
При запуске фильма на ГлавТВ происходит отключение и перезагрузка приставки.
При воспроизведении HD видеофайлов формата mkv размером порядка 7 Gb наблюдается периодическое «торможение» изображения. Кроме того, 3D видеофильмы ...
Приставкой Ugoos am3 пользуюсь с августа 2021. После подключения хаба USB пропало изображение через разъём HDMI.
1 231
Не выводится изображение на телевизор. Индикатор показывает работу приставки (переключается из дежурного в рабочий режим) . Кабель HDMI и гнездо в ...
3
1 544
Медиаплеер не поддерживает некоторые приложения, в частности, Яндекс. Сбрасывал до заводских настроек, не помогло Стоит андроид 6. Думаю, надо ...
